Nokia 5800 XpressMusic
The phone is not one of the thinnest out there, but not that thick also.. it’s also narrower and longer compared to the iphone and it’s generally because of the 3.2 in. widescreen display.. the phone really feels good to hold..the user interface is very intuitive and easy to use! but i’d actually prefer the software to be s40 instead of s60 for it to becaome more easy to use and intuitive..
First of, the phone comes with a lot of accessories together with the package.
- stylus
- Hard carrying case
- Wrist strap
- Stand for movie watching and slide shows
- Additional stylus
- Stereo hands-free/headphones for a 3.5mm jack
- microUSB cable
- TV-out cable
- Wall Charger
- 8 GB microSD card
- DVD
- User Manual
Can’t think of any accessories that i’ll be needing.. well, aside from upgrading it to 16 gigs memory and a screen protector since this is a touch screen phone. i liked the case that came with it cause it’s made from hard rubber and you can slide the phone from either side.. the phone generally looked good, i liked the red one.. it’s the color that i bought.. the blue one looked pale in color.
when it comes to connectivity, it packs a lot! it has wi-fi, stereo bluetooth, gps, mms, sms, video calling capable, can of course do internet and e-mail and on and on..webpage rendering is as is on a pc and very easy to navigate..
when it comes to text input, the phone offers a lot of options from full qwerty to standard alphanumerics to handwriting recognition and also has a mini qwerty.. very good sound quality, the best that i’ve heard from a mobile phone! both on speakerphone and with supplied headset! has very good screen for watching movies and browsing through pictures due to it’s high resolution and bright display..
the only cons for me about this phone would be the earpiece when it comes to making calls, you would need to move the earpiece around your ear and find a good spot to hear the other end and that it’s an s60 os, aside from that a very good phone!
Specs |
|
| Modes | GSM 850 / GSM 900 / GSM 1800 / GSM 1900 WCDMA 850 / WCDMA 1900 North American version |
| Weight | 3.84 oz (109 g) |
| Dimensions | 4.37″ x 2.04″ x 0.61″ (111 x 52 x 15.5 mm) |
| Form Factor | Bar Internal Antenna |
| Battery | Talk: 5 hours max. (300 minutes) Standby: 408 hours max. (17 days) WCDMA mode 1320 mAh |
| Display | Type: LCD (Color TFT/TFD) Resolution: 360 x 640 pixels 3.2″ diagonal Colors: 16.7 million (24-bit) |
| Platform / OS | S60 (Symbian) 5th Edition (Symbian 9.4) |
| Processor | 369 MHz ARM 11 |
| Memory | 81 MB (internal memory available to user for storage) |
| Phone Book Capacity | shared memory |
